In August of 2008 I started to map the location of Canadian law firms and lawyer’s offices on Google Maps. It’s a cooperative project, open to any an all who have an interest in making this information more easily and freely available — and who have a Google account.

We’d like you to join us in putting Canadian lawyers on the map.

Adding a location is a simple matter:

  1. Log in to your Google account.
  2. Click this link (or the “view larger map” link beneath the map below) to go to a full version of the map.
  3. Click “Edit” at the top of the list of firms.
  4. Enter the address you’d like to add into the text box at the very top of the page and click Search Maps.
  5. When the result appears, click the link that will add it to this map
  6. In the window that will then pop up, choose to edit it in rich text mode to provide
      * the firm name in the title box
      * the address and telelphone number of the firm
      * and a live link to their website

  7. Click on the coloured marker to bring up the array of possible markers, and choose the one for the relevant province or territory.

Here are the (arbitrary) markers for the various provinces and territories:

map_icons.png

Your new location will appear at the very bottom of the list of lawyers and firms. With the edit button still clicked, you can drag the address up the list and drop it in the appropriate spot.

Don’t forget to click “save” and “done” when you’re finished.
